Leticia Van de Putte: Clay Jenkins is my Texan of the Year



http://www.dallasnews.com/opinion/latest-columns/20141204-leticia-van-de-putte-clay-jenkins-is-my-texan-of-the-year.ece

In times of crisis, our world discovers its true leaders — those individuals who not only take charge, but come up with real solutions based on clear thinking that benefits all.

Unfortunately, it is also in times of crisis — real or perceived — that many people, including politicians, respond in the worst way possible.

So easily, they give in to their basest fear. Or even worse, they incite it. They look for a scapegoat or respond only to the loudest, shrillest voices. At a time when the public looks to them for leadership, they instead gravitate toward their instinct, which is political survival.

This year, Dallas County Judge Clay Jenkins has defied the fearmongers and shown true leadership and a calm, level head. For this reason, Jenkins is my nomination for 2014 Dallas Morning News Texan of the Year.
